Also note that, as far as the iPAQ hx4700 ROM’s are concerned, there are slightly improved versions of the reviewed PDAV61KBD fixing, for example, the lack of the above-mentioned cursor mode switcher link. sanjay1951 has also released a lite version of the ROM removing bloatware like Internet Explorer, games, WMP, PowerPoint and some other less-useful software like BT Phone Manager. Algasystems and Da_G have also released some slightly updated / teaked ROM’s. These ROM’s are all linked from the main hx4700 WM6.1 thread. Make sure you check out the individual posts discussing these ROM versions; the thread starter post also lists the number of the post containing the related info. For example, sanjay1951’s latest (and, therefore, most recommended) two versions (a full and a “lite” version) are explained in detailed in post #425; that is, HERE.

I'm running WM6.1 (one of sanjay's ROMs, to be exact) on my now-perfectly-functional (well, except for the backup battery) hx4700, and it runs great! (Normally, I'd stay with WM2003SE, but I HAD to try out Opera Mobile 9.5 on it...) I don't notice a lot of filesys.exe compaction slowdown, and when it does hit, it doesn't feel too severe. (When it's not running its course, it feels pretty snappy-about the same as WM2003SE.)
I can definitely confirm that iLauncher will work, as well as PocketBreeze. I haven't tested Resco Keyboard Pro since I never use it(I only got it as part of a pack that also includes Resco Explorer and Resco Photo Viewer), but it should still work. I don't use TomTom or any other GPS software, so I can't comment on that(though they all should still work).
It's just too bad that no one can get SDHC out of the SD slot...then again, I can always get myself a nice, spacious, 32 GB CompactFlash card while using the SD slot for something else.
Overall, I'd say that the move to WM6.1 is worth it if you don't mind any possible hits to responsiveness and want to use new apps that aren't WM2003SE-compliant(Opera Mobile 9.5 in particular, though there are others).
